This 13T motor pinion is intended as a drop-in replacement for electric RC drivetrains that share the stated geometry. Constructed from 40Cr steel with a hardened black surface, the pinion features 13 teeth, a 0.5mm module and a round 2.2mm motor bore. Retention is by two 3x3 set screws.
When fitted the pinion acts as the interface between the motor shaft and the primary or spur gear, providing a compact and durable drive point. Check that the motor shaft accepts a 2.2mm bore and that the mating gear has a 0.5mm module before installation. Proper mesh and alignment are required, so fit the gear while the drivetrain is assembled and confirm concentricity before final tightening.
For maintenance and ratio tuning the pinion lets you swap tooth counts while keeping a consistent tooth profile. The hardened 40Cr construction is chosen to improve resistance to wear under normal RC loads compared with softer alternatives.
